bullet  General Notes:

Bernard went to De La Salle Grammar School, Scott Rd, Sheffield and became a founder member of the "Old Boys Club" based at Beauchief Hall. Prior to the Second World war Bernard worked for Sheffield Corporation as a Clerk in the Electricty Department. He did military service during WWII in the REME and on his return from service bacame a teacher. His teaching career was spent at St. Patrick's RC & St Peter's RC Comp. schools, Sheffield. The family home was 24 Meadowhead Sheffield and the family were active parishioners of Our Lady's & St Thomas' RC Church on Meadowhead.

Bernard married Monica Genevieve PILLEY, daughter of Oswald George PILLEY and Maud Elizabeth (Mabel) CARROLL, on 17 Jun 1941 in Sheffield, Yorkshire, England. (Monica Genevieve PILLEY was born on 25 Mar 1912 in Sheffield, Yorkshire, England, died on 30 Sep 1987 in Sheffield, Yorkshire, England and was buried in 1987 in Abbey Lane Cemetry, Sheffield, England.)
